What Drives the Cost of Energy Storage Inverters?

Energy storage inverters are the backbone of modern power systems, converting DC electricity from batteries into AC for grid or commercial use. Their cost composition typically includes:

  • Materials (60-70%): Semiconductor chips, capacitors, and cooling systems dominate expenses.
  • Labor and Manufacturing (15-20%): Assembly, testing, and quality control.
  • R&D and Certification (10-15%): Compliance with safety standards like UL 1741 or IEC 62109.

Material Costs: The Heavyweight Player

IGBT modules (Insulated Gate Bipolar Transistors) alone account for 30% of total material costs. Recent supply chain disruptions have increased silicon wafer prices by 22% since 2022, according to BloombergNEF.

"Inverter costs could drop 8-12% annually through 2030 as manufacturers adopt wide-bandgap semiconductors like silicon carbide." – Global Market Insights, 2023

Key Factors Influencing Price Variations

  • Power Rating: A 100kW commercial inverter costs ~$18,000 vs. $4,500 for a 10kW residential unit.
  • Efficiency Ratings: 98% efficiency models cost 15% more than 95% models but reduce energy losses.
  • Topology: Centralized vs. modular designs impact scalability and maintenance costs.

Future Trends Shaping Inverter Economics

  • Bidirectional inverters for vehicle-to-grid (V2G) applications
  • Cloud-based monitoring reducing operational costs by up to 30%
  • Recyclable aluminum frames cutting material expenses
